Hi all

 

I am attempting to move a list of data from one column to multiple:

 

Capture.PNG

The country column is the data a need to list in individual columns. There is an additional column before connection type with client names (I didn't include as this is sensitive) but I need to group by name and then list all countries associated. I thought that Cross Tab would be the best way to achieve this but I haven't made it work yet...

 

Can anyone help?

Can you provide a before and after picture of the data?  Dummy data is fine.  I think you just want to configure the cross tab tool as such:  group on name, your column headers will be the country field, and your value field would be your connection type.

 

But without seeing a before and after I can't say for sure.
